How they compare

Indonesia currently reports 52.5% against 51.2% in India, a difference of 1.3%.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 6 shared years of data; in 2000 it was India ahead.

India ranks 34th and Indonesia ranks 31st of 185 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, India averaged higher in 2 and Indonesia in 1.

Number of deaths ages 5-14 due to communicable diseases and maternal, prenatal and nutrition conditions divided by number of all deaths ages 5-14, expressed by percentage. Communicable diseases and maternal, prenatal and nutrition conditions included infectious and parasitic diseases, respiratory infections, and nutritional deficiencies such as underweight and stunting.
